Where each one falls short
Documented limitations, not opinions. Every one is a constraint you would hit in normal use.
Cube
- Per-developer licensing can be expensive for large analytics teams
- Additional cost for Explorer and Viewer roles beyond developers
- Semantic layer approach requires upfront modeling investment
- Smaller connector ecosystem than dedicated BI platforms
- May be overengineered for simple reporting needs
Marketing Evolution
- Pricing not published on vendor website; enterprise data infrastructure platform requires custom quote

Answered from the vendors’ own pages
Cube: What is the cost per developer on Cube?
Starter plan costs $40/developer/month. Premium adds embedded analytics at $80/developer/month. Explorer and Viewer roles cost $40 and $20/month respectively.
SourceMarketing Evolution: How much does Marketing Evolution Substrate cost?
Marketing Evolution does not publish pricing on its website. The Substrate platform is sold through enterprise contracts requiring custom quotes.
SourceCube: What uptime SLAs does Cube offer?
Premium plan offers 99.950% uptime SLA. Enterprise plan provides 99.990% uptime SLA with dedicated support.
SourceMarketing Evolution: What is the cost of Darwin proactive intelligence?
Darwin is included with the Substrate platform. Marketing Evolution does not publish per-user or per-instance pricing on its website.
SourceCube: Can I use Cube for free?
Yes, the Free plan includes basic data source connection, semantic modeling, workbooks, and dashboards for hobbyists and personal projects.
SourceMarketing Evolution: Does Marketing Evolution offer a free trial?
Marketing Evolution directs users to request a demo or get started on the website. No free trial period is mentioned or offered.
